Sam Lundin is the Founder and CEO of Vimbly Group, which invests in and grows technology-enabled companies. The company consists of 9 business units and operates a portfolio of businesses where it has contributed its IP and is responsible for technology strategy and infrastructure. He also manages Vimbly.com, which shows available times for thousands of local activities, date ideas, and things to do that can be booked directly with the best price guarantee.
Sam graduated from Cornell University with a BS in Applied Economics & Management. He is a former investment banker and has been featured in both print and television media such as Fox News, Bloomberg, CBS, and Business Insider. Before launching Vimbly, he was a tech investor at Perry Capital, and a technology investment banker at Lazard specializing in mergers and acquisitions.
